This innovative bridge design is made from fiberglass reinforced polymer (FRP) material, which offers superior corrosion resistance and durability compared to traditional concrete and steel bridges.     The application of fiberglass materials in bridge construction has changed the rules of the game. It not only improves the overall quality and service life of the bridge, but also significantly reduces maintenance costs. This is because FRP materials are inherently corrosion-resistant, reducing the need for frequent repairs and maintenance. Additionally, its durability ensures that the bridge structure will stand the test of time, providing a long-lasting solution for transportation infrastructure.

    In addition, the use of monolithic fiberglass bridges also has a positive impact on the environment. Due to its long service life, the need for constant replacement and repair is minimized, thereby reducing the overall environmental impact of bridge construction. This makes it an environmentally friendly option for sustainable infrastructure development.

    The versatility of monolithic FRP bridges also allows for greater design freedom and customization. Using fiberglass materials, bridges can be built in a variety of shapes and sizes to meet the specific needs of different transportation routes. This flexibility opens up new possibilities in bridge construction, giving engineers and designers more options to create efficient and beautiful bridges.
